BlackRock capital allocation belief sees $3.48 million in inventory gross sales


Saba Capital Administration, L.P., a big shareholder of BlackRock (NYSE:BLK) Capital Allocation Time period Belief (NYSE:BCAT), has reported promoting shares price roughly $3.48 million. The transactions occurred over two days, with shares offered at costs starting from $16.27 to $16.37 every. In line with InvestingPro information, BCAT at the moment presents a powerful 21.26% dividend yield and maintains a market capitalization of $1.75 billion. The belief’s shares have demonstrated low value volatility, buying and selling between $14.68 and $17.18 over the previous 52 weeks.

On December 12, the agency offered 59,608 shares at $16.37 per share, adopted by the sale of 153,886 shares at $16.27 per share on December 13. Following these transactions, Saba Capital Administration holds 13,727,726 shares within the belief.

These gross sales had been disclosed in a latest SEC submitting, underscoring ongoing exercise by main stakeholders within the belief.
